Steps to Take After a Car Accident


If you find yourself included in a car accident, taking certain steps can strengthen your case when working with an attorney. Here's a comprehensive list:

  1. Ensure Safety: Check for injuries and make sure the security of all celebrations involved.
  2. Call the Police: File an authorities report to develop a main record of the incident.
  3. File the Scene: Take images of the accident scene, automobile damage, and any visible injuries.
  4. Collect Information: Collect contact information from other motorists and witnesses.
  5. Seek Medical Attention: Get evaluated by a medical expert, even if injuries appear small.
  6. Notify Your Insurance Company: Report the accident but limitation conversations about liability up until you've spoken with an attorney.
  7. Keep All Records: Maintain all files connected to the accident, consisting of medical expenses, repair work estimates, and correspondence with your insurer.
  8. Contact a Car Accident Attorney: As quickly as possible, speak with an attorney to discuss your case and available choices.

Often Asked Questions


1. Just how much does it cost to employ a car accident attorney?

The majority of car accident attorneys deal with a contingency cost basis. This suggests you won't pay any costs upfront; instead, the attorney takes a portion of the settlement or judgment awarded in your case, generally ranging from 25% to 40%.

2. What should I try to find in a consultation?

During your initial consultation, think about inquiring about the attorney's experience, case success rates, techniques for your specific case, the estimated timeline, and upfront fees or costs related to the services.

3. The length of time does a car accident case take to settle?

The timeline for settling a car accident case can vary substantially based on the intricacy of the case, the desire of the parties to work out, and whether lawsuits is needed. Some cases may settle within a couple of months, while others can take years.

4. What happens if I was partially at fault for the accident?

Most states operate under relative negligence laws, implying if you are found partially at fault, your compensation may be minimized by your percentage of fault. It's important to seek advice from an attorney to understand how this might use to your case.
